Output 40de4d3cfe9eaa9384aaba47537615f4fd4a40bed142a7e9c968e3effda525b3:0

value
3042819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 572c3c5412f435f2b8c04837ab548093042efbb3 OP_EQUAL
address
MFr61fdTRx9256jh6MkY7op83eVyBmikyB
transaction
40de4d3cfe9eaa9384aaba47537615f4fd4a40bed142a7e9c968e3effda525b3
spent
true